Ingredients

1 1/2 lbs lean ground beef
2 medium onions , chopped
2 tablespoons minced garlic
1 can diced tomatoes
1 jar spaghetti sauce
8 ounces uncooked small shell pasta
2 cups reduced-fat sour cream
11 slices reduced fat provolone cheese
1 cup shredded part-skim mozzarella cheese

Instructions

1.Preheat oven to 375°F.
2.In a large skillet, cook beef, onions, and garlic over medium heat until meat is no longer pink and onions are tender. Drain.
3.Stir in tomatoes and spaghetti sauce.
4.Cook pasta according to package directions. Drain.
5.Spread 1 cup meat sauce into a greased 13x9-inch baking dish.
6.Layer with half of the pasta, 1 cup meat sauce, 1 cup sour cream and half of the provolone cheese.
7.Repeat layers.
8.Top with remaining meat sauce and sprinkle with mozzarella cheese.
9.Cover and bake for 45 minutes.
10.Uncover and bake for an additional 10-15 minutes or until bubbly.
